About Umarpur
According to Census 2011 information the location code or village code of Umarpur village is 113362. Umarpur village is located in Dhampur tehsil of Bijnor district in Uttar Pradesh, India. It is situated 15km away from sub-district headquarter Dhampur (tehsildar office) and 30km away from district headquarter Bijnor. As per 2009 stats, Chakgoverdhan is the gram panchayat of Umarpur village.
The total geographical area of village is 38.05 hectares. Umarpur has a total population of 59 peoples, out of which male population is 36 while female population is 23. This results in a sex ratio of approximately 638 females for every 1,000 males. Literacy rate of umarpur village is 27.12% out of which 33.33% males and 17.39% females are literate. There are about 12 houses in umarpur village.
Bahraur is nearest town to umarpur village for all major economic activities.

Population of Umarpur
Particulars | Total | Male | Female |
---|---|---|---|
Total Population | 59 | 36 | 23 |
Literate Population | 16 | 12 | 4 |
Illiterate Population | 43 | 24 | 19 |
